The degree of variation in or the numerical spread of the data is known as ________.
A) quartile
B) median
C) dispersion
D) mean
Dispersion
A statistical measure that describes the spread of or variation in a set of data values.
Variation
The difference in data set values from the mean, highlighting the dispersion or spread of a set of data points.
Quartile
A quartile is a type of statistical measure that divides a data set into four equal parts, revealing the spread and tendencies of the data.
